begins where realism ends. We are talking about decay times ranging from 15 seconds to infinity . At this level, the reverb ceases to be an effect that supports the dry signal; it becomes a new, autonomous instrument. The original transient (the sharp attack of a drum or a plucked string) triggers a vast, evolving cloud of sound that outlasts the source material entirely.

Max out the virtual room size parameter. If your plugin features internal modulation (like pitch shifting or chorus within the reverb tail), introduce it here. Modulation keeps the infinite tail from sounding static and stale, adding a swirling, organic movement to the sound. Advanced Techniques for Audio Producers A small sound lost in a massive, infinite
